maintained

The gardener maintained the flower beds all summer.

Definition
  1. Adjective:
    • Kept in good condition: Kept in a proper state of repair or upkeep.
    • Continued or retained: Kept in existence or continued; held onto.
Examples of Usage
  • Adjective:
    • The house was old but beautifully maintained.
    • He has a maintained interest in classical music.
    • The software requires a maintained internet connection to function.
Advanced Usage
  • "Well-maintained": A common collocation emphasizing something is kept in very good condition.
    • The park is clean and well-maintained.
  • "Poorly-maintained": A common collocation indicating something is not kept in good condition.
    • The accident was caused by poorly-maintained equipment.
Variants and Related Words
  • Maintain (verb): To keep in an existing state; to preserve or keep up.
    • It is important to maintain your car regularly.
  • Maintenance (noun): The process of maintaining or the state of being maintained.
    • The building requires regular maintenance.
Synonyms
  • Upkept: Kept in good condition.
  • Preserved: Kept safe from harm or decay.
  • Sustained: Continued or kept going over time.
Related Phrases
  • "Maintained that...": (From the verb 'maintain') To state or assert something as true.
    • She maintained that she was innocent.
